In Bishkek, a reserve of buses has been formed in case of an increase in passenger traffic
According to the ministry, the number of buses will be determined based on the actual demand for transportation.
From December 27 to 31, six buses will be in reserve: two for the routes Bishkek – Karakol (north and south) and Bishkek – Naryn;
From the "Ak-Kula" bus station, one bus has also been allocated for the Bishkek – Talas route from December 22 to 27, and during the period from December 27 to 31, two large-capacity buses will be available, which can be used for additional trips if necessary.
